<p><strong>Effects of leaf domatia on intraguild interactions between <em>Amblyseius swirskii</em> and <em>Phytoseiulus persimilis</em> (Acari: Phytoseiidae)</strong></p>
Leaf domatia as a habitat-produced structure is considered to moderate the interaction intensity among guild parties.
